My husband and I have stayed at Yun's Place 3 times now, and they are very accommodating. It's a decent location just off the exit for I-90 through Boston and about a 5 minute drive to the downtown center. It's not the best location if you do not have a car, and want to walk to restaurants and shops. But you can walk to the Charles River path in about 10 minutes and to the Harvard train stop in about 20 - so it is possible. They also have off street parking for you.
Yun and Alan are such nice hosts and their breakfast is great and the coffee is unlimited. They also give you lots of bottled water to take when you go out. We have enjoyed staying there the 3 times we have, and will probably be back for more. The rooms are nice and the bathroom is right down the hall. It has never been crowded as they have only 2 rooms and is in a very quiet neighborhood.
